ytdl fork with additional features
A GUI program that runs on top of yt-dlp and ffmpeg to download videos and audio. This project is only for educational purpose DO NOT SELL . DO NOT
plagiarize. USE AT YOUR RISK . I DO NOT PROMOTE ANY ILLEGAL DOWNLOADS .
Version 23.xx.yy coming soon....
Update model 3 will built using python 3.8.10
Windows 7 support will be dropped in Oct 2024.
yt-dlp and youtube-dl licensed under The Unlicense
FFmpeg is licensed under the GNU Lesser General Public License (LGPL) version 2.1 or later.
AtomicParsley is licensed under GPL-2.0 license
pygame is licensed under GNU LGPL version 2.1
Expanded supported websites
made with python 3.8 and 3.10
multi video supports que
multi video supports more URLs other than youtube.com
Hyper user
Wav format for playlist and more.
- Clone this repository
- Install the following dependencies
python >= 3.8.10
ffmpeg >= 3.3.4
yt-dlp latest version
- ffmpeg and yt-dlp should be placed in cloned dir Libraries
pyinstaller==5.6.2
Pillow==9.4.0
yt-dlp==2023.1.6
virtualenv==20.17.1
pycryptodomex==3.16.0
requests==2.28.1
psutil==5.9.4
pytube==12.1.2
- Run the builder.ps1
- Build will be generated
./dist/Youtube-dl GUI/
folder
- Follow step 1 and 2 as above
- Give permission to builder.sh
chmod +x builder.sh
- Before compiling change few lines in code which ask for logo.ico
- Run the builder.sh
./builder.sh
- Build will be generated
./dist/Youtube-dl GUI/
folder
Bugs and suggestions should be reported at: /ytdl/issues Select the type of issue
Bug report
Feature request
Ask a question
Please see the issues section before opening issue
Duplicate issues will not be entertained and make sure you are on latest version
Adding Screenshots/videos will be helpful.
Do not include database files, other dependencies in PR.
If you have liked my work and want to support please consider donating.
Help to keep Ytdl active and running by donating. It will be really helpful and appreciated if you donate or contribute to us. Any amount is appreciated.
: sourabhkv@upi
:PinakiSahu
Supported Websites youtube-dl
Supported websites yt-dlp
youtube-dl
yt-dlp
Pytube
ffmpeg
AtomicParsley
Pygame
Inno Setup